Actual near-shore water temperatures in Port Fairy can vary by several degrees from the values shown, particularly after heavy rain, strong southerlies, or prolonged windy conditions. Certain wind patterns can trigger upwelling, where cooler, deeper water is pushed to the surface and replaces the warmer top layer, leading to noticeable short-term changes in water temperature.

Annual Water Temperature Trend
Port Fairy sits near the western end of Victoria’s coastline, where the Southern Ocean meets the Great Australian Bight, and this location keeps sea temperatures cool throughout the year. In summer, the water is usually at its warmest, typically ranging from about 17–20°C, which feels refreshing rather than warm on hot days. Autumn brings a gradual drop to roughly 15–18°C, while winter is noticeably cold, often around 12–14°C. Spring warms slowly, with water temperatures commonly sitting between 13–16°C, influenced by winds and changing weather patterns.
Monthly Water Temperature Range (Min, Max & Average)
| Month | Min | Avg | Max |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 15°C | 19°C | 22°C |
| February | 17°C | 19°C | 22°C |
| March | 17°C | 19°C | 21°C |
| April | 15°C | 18°C | 20°C |
| May | 14°C | 16°C | 18°C |
| June | 12°C | 14°C | 16°C |
| July | 11°C | 13°C | 15°C |
| August | 11°C | 13°C | 14°C |
| September | 11°C | 13°C | 14°C |
| October | 12°C | 14°C | 16°C |
| November | 13°C | 16°C | 18°C |
| December | 15°C | 18°C | 21°C |

Swimming Conditions
Swimming is allowed at Port Fairy and is popular, particularly during the warmer months. The town benefits from a mix of more sheltered beaches and river mouth areas, which can offer calmer conditions compared to fully exposed open-ocean beaches. This makes swimming more approachable for a wide range of visitors when conditions are favourable. Patrolled areas typically operate in summer, adding an extra layer of safety, as rips and currents can still be present. Outside peak summer, many swimmers opt for wetsuits to stay comfortable in the cooler water. Overall, Port Fairy offers inviting swimming opportunities by southern Victorian standards, with clean water and varied coastal settings suited to relaxed dips and longer swims alike.
